AI Holders Summary · Q2 2026

Philip Morris International's institutional footprint of 2,900+ holders and $131B in reported value is large for a tobacco company in an era of ESG divestment — and that persistence tells an important story about institutional capital allocation under pressure. PM's transformation into a smoke-free products company (IQOS, ZYN nicotine pouches) has created a valuation and regulatory profile that is increasingly hard to categorize: part tobacco-for-income, part consumer-healthcare for growth. The top-holder roster shows Capital Research, T. Rowe Price, and Norges Bank as active-manager advocates alongside BlackRock and Vanguard's passive core. The buy-and-hold discipline of these managers reflects PM's exceptional dividend yield (roughly 6%) combined with a declining-but-stable cigarette cash flow that funds both the dividend and the smoke-free R&D investment.

The smoke-free pivot is the analytical key. IQOS heated-tobacco units and ZYN oral nicotine pouches represent roughly 15-20% of PM's revenue and are growing at a double-digit pace while combustible cigarette volumes decline. For institutional investors who cannot own traditional tobacco names due to ESG screens, PM's smoke-free mix offers a partial workaround, and that has kept PM in many mandate-eligible portfolios that have otherwise shed tobacco. The dividend yield — historically 5-7% — is the income anchor that keeps PM in fixed-income-alternative and high-income equity mandates regardless of ESG considerations.

The holder set reflects both segments: passive large-cap holdings (BlackRock, Vanguard, State Street) from index inclusion, plus active advocates (Capital Research, T. Rowe Price, Norges Bank) who articulate the smoke-free transition thesis. Capital in particular has been a vocal PM bull across multiple cycles, and their continued large position signals that their fundamental case for the transition hasn't broken.
